Drug Delivery Capital Raising: Strategies for Startups
For drug delivery capital raising, startups must navigate a financing landscape where scientific promise must be matched with rigorous financial discipline. At Zaidwood Capital, we see that early planning across seed, Series A, and growth equity rounds is critical for emerging companies in this space.
Establishing a defensible valuation is a fundamental first step. An effective approach for advanced drug delivery systems valuation often blends discounted cash flow analysis with comparable company benchmarks. While platform technologies command premiums, we caution against inflated projections that erode investor confidence. This process aligns with broader Medical Device capital raising trends, where technical milestones significantly influence deal terms.

Clinical Milestone Financial Model
Overview
Building on our capital formation capabilities, our firm offers a Clinical Milestone Financial Model as part of our boutique investment bank services. For companies engaged in drug delivery capital raising, this dynamic financial model directly maps clinical triggers, such as IND filings and Phase I trial completions, to planned capital infusions and valuation step-ups, creating a clear de-risking narrative for investors.
Features
Key features include scenario analysis modeling multiple clinical outcomes, sensitivity tables that quantify the dilution impact of timeline or cost changes, milestone-based funding triggers that link tranche releases to specific trial results, and dilution modeling for advanced drug delivery systems valuation at each tranche.

Capital Stack Optimization Tool
Overview
The Capital Stack Optimization Tool evaluates the cost and dilution impact of each capital source and recommends the most efficient capital structure. For firms pursuing drug delivery capital raising, we analyze how grants, debt, and equity layers interact, then identify the blend that may reduce your weighted average cost of capital while preserving ownership.
Features
- Dilution sensitivity charts map how incremental equity rounds affect founder and early-investor ownership across multiple funding scenarios, giving leadership a visual basis for structured negotiations.
- Debt-service coverage analysis stress-tests your projected cash flows against proposed loan terms, confirming that leverage levels stay within prudent thresholds even under downside cases.
- Grant eligibility screening cross-references your technology readiness and clinical milestones against active public and foundation programs, often surfacing non-dilutive capital that complements advanced drug delivery systems valuation work.
